When interviewing a prospective Security Infrastructure Engineer, it’s essential to delve into both their technical capabilities and their approach to security challenges. Here are five critical questions to consider:
- Can you describe a time when you identified and mitigated a security threat? What was the situation, and what steps did you take to resolve it?
- How do you stay informed about the latest security threats and technologies? Can you give an example of how you’ve applied new knowledge to your work?
- Explain the process you follow when conducting a security risk assessment. How do you prioritize vulnerabilities?
- Discuss your experience with designing and implementing a secure network architecture. What were the key considerations and challenges?
- How do you balance the need for strong security measures with usability and business requirements?
These questions help assess the candidate’s practical experience, problem-solving skills, and their ability to stay up-to-date with the rapidly evolving field of cybersecurity. They also provide insight into the candidate’s communication skills and how they approach the trade-offs between security, usability, and business needs.

In interviewing Security Infrastructure Engineer candidates, it’s vital to cover a range of questions that assess both their technical expertise and their approach to security challenges. Here are five key questions to consider:
- How do you approach securing a new cloud deployment, and what specific security controls do you prioritize?
- Describe a challenging security project you’ve worked on. What was your role, and what outcome did you achieve?
- How do you evaluate the effectiveness of your security measures? Can you give an example of how you’ve adapted your strategy based on feedback or new information?
- Can you explain a time when you had to communicate a complex security issue to a non-technical audience? How did you ensure your message was understood?
- What is your approach to incident response and recovery in the event of a security breach?
These questions aim to probe the candidate’s technical knowledge, problem-solving strategies, and their ability to communicate effectively with various stakeholders. Understanding their past experiences and how they’ve handled specific situations can give valuable insights into their capabilities and fit for your team.
